Output 63cc840132f5080f8f1a6fb8dc5873ef74c3d567ed0cbbb5f25bf2d41b5300e8:0

value
65629
script pubkey
OP_0 OP_PUSHBYTES_32 e34cd74555f4775be055c747342b39dcc7e1306fdf519704e7c1d5eac22091eb
address
bc1qudxdw32473m4hcz4carng2eemnr7zvr0magewp88c8274s3qj84sy4ugau
transaction
63cc840132f5080f8f1a6fb8dc5873ef74c3d567ed0cbbb5f25bf2d41b5300e8
spent
true